Increasing numbers of Influenza reported in Adams County

There have been over 150 cases of laboratory diagnosed Influenza A reported in Adams County so far this flu season, most in the past three weeks.

There are likely many more cases of individuals that were not tested by their doctor or who did not seek medical care for their illness.

Due to the increase in flu activity, Adams County Health Department would like to provide the following information about “the flu”.

Influenza is a lung and respiratory infection caused by one of three virus types (A, B or C). Influenza illness can be severe, lasting as long as 10 – 14 days.
